Foraging is a Gathering Skill used to collect materials from wild plant nodes in dungeons.

How to Forage

Foraging requires a pair of Old Gloves.png Gloves and/or Iron Shovel.png Shovel to be equipped in the Toolbag.

Tip: Bring both Gloves and Shovel when gathering! The ability to gather from a wild plant depends on the type of Foraging Tool equipped.


Additionally, a Well-Crafted Spile.png Spile may be equipped to increase certain item droprates from plants.

Hint: Spiles are used to increase the chance of specific Foraging drops A higher-level Spile does not have the collection bonuses of a lower-level Spile


To forage:

  1. Stand next to and click-and-hold a wild plant to start a charging animation with sound.
  2. Once the animation is at its peak, release the mouse button to gather the plant.


Foraging Locations & Re-spawn Timers

Overworld Dungeons

Wild plant nodes are available in all zones and cluster in set locations on the overworld.

Hint: Foraging nodes share spawns. If you are not satisfied with your selection of nodes, exit the area and come back to see fresh nodes.

Re-spawn timers vary; check for new nodes 3 hours (length of 1 in-game day) from last gathering.

Beacon Dungeons

  • Gathering nodes are randomized per each dungeon floor
  • If you leave the floor, the nodes are lost for that dungeon run
  • New nodes spawn every run
